This is “The Big Whistle,” by Jerrold Beim, a vintage, previously-owned hardcover book published in 1968 by Macmillan as part of the “Readingtime Book” series and illustrated by Richard Loehle. It shows general handling wear. The story follows a young boy whose unusually loud whistle causes trouble until he discovers it can be used for something helpful when he becomes lost in a large department store. Adapted from Beim’s earlier story “Twelve-O’Clock Whistle,” the book highlights how an annoying trait can become an unexpected strength, making it a charming early-reader title for children ages 4–8.
